Refrigerated Ladyfinger Cake

This is a delicious refrigerated cake using Lady finger. It is nice sweet a creamy cake that is very popular in Curacao on the holidays.

Ingredients
- 1 package ladyfinger cookies
- 1 medium can (about 10 oz) crushed pineapple in juice
- 1 lime
- 1 egg yolk
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 lb (2 sticks / 1 cup) butter, softened
- 1 bottle Avoset whipping cream, chilled
- Chocolate sprinkles, for decoration
- Rum, to taste (optional)

Preparation
- Using a hand mixer, beat the softened butter and sugar together until smooth and creamy.
- Beat the egg yolk, then gradually mix it into the butter and sugar mixture until well combined.
- Drain the crushed pineapple, reserving the pineapple juice in a separate bowl or glass. Add the drained pineapple to the butter mixture.
- While mixing slowly, squeeze the lime juice into the pineapple mixture and continue mixing until well combined.
- Add a small amount of water and sugar to the reserved pineapple juice, if needed, adjusting the sweetness to taste.
- If the cake is being prepared for adults, add a little rum to the pineapple juice mixture, to taste.
- Dip each ladyfinger into the pineapple juice mixture for about 4 seconds, just long enough to moisten it without making it too soft. Arrange the soaked ladyfingers in a single layer in the bottom of a glass baking dish.
- Spread a layer of the pineapple-butter mixture over the ladyfingers. Repeat the layers of soaked ladyfingers and pineapple-butter mixture until all of the mixture has been used.
- Whip the chilled cream until light, fluffy, and able to hold soft peaks. Spread the whipped cream evenly over the top of the cake.
- Decorate the top with chocolate sprinkles.
-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or until thoroughly chilled and set. For the best texture, refrigerate overnight.
- Slice, serve chilled, and enjoy!
